Winter driving in the snow

Driving is never something to be taken for granted but in the icy, snowy conditions of winter it takes a special level of attention. People make the same mistakes over and over it seems (like the #1 mistake of driving too fast) so if you don’t want to be the next unfortunate soul to go skidding into the ditch (or worse) you might want to take a closer look at your winter driving habits and make sure you’re not guilty of one of the 10 deadly mistakes of winter driving:

#1 Driving too fast

#2 Following too closely

#3 Over-correcting on ice

#4 Driving tired

#5 Driving in poor visibility

#6 Driving on back roads

#7 Not winterizing your vehicle (snow tires, spare key, etc)

#8 Not having an emergency kit

#9 Leaving the vehicle when stranded or lost

#10 Failing to check weather conditions before leaving
